WebFeb 13, 2024 · In the manufacturing process, takt time is the rate at which you need to finish making a product to meet customer demand. For example: If the takt time of your company’s production line is two minutes, it means that the final product should be completed in two minutes if you are to meet your customer demand. WebIn manufacturing, resource bottleneck analysis generally works hand-in-hand with the Theory of Constraints (TOC). The TOC tries to identify the bottleneck and then implement steps to quickly solve and move the bottleneck to another area of the process, and then repeat the cycle. thai airways baggage claim

WebApr 10, 2024 · This increases the thruput of the process. Examine your production schedule. If a process is used to make several different products that use varying amounts of the bottleneck’s time, then an analysis of the production schedule can create a product mix that minimizes overall demand on the bottleneck.
